The Role Of Art Underwriting In Supporting The Arts Community

art underwriting, often referred to as sponsorships or funding, plays a crucial role in supporting the arts community. This form of financial support enables artists and art organizations to create, produce, and exhibit their work without having to solely rely on ticket sales or commercial ventures. In this article, we will delve into the significance of art underwriting and how it impacts the arts community.

art underwriting involves individuals, businesses, or foundations providing financial support to artists, galleries, museums, and other art-related entities. This support can come in various forms, including grants, sponsorships, donations, or partnerships. The main goal of art underwriting is to foster creativity, innovation, and cultural enrichment by providing artists with the resources they need to pursue their artistic endeavors.

One of the key benefits of art underwriting is that it helps to fill the funding gap that many artists and art organizations face. Creating art can be a costly endeavor, from purchasing materials to renting studio space to marketing and promoting their work. Without financial support, many artists would struggle to bring their projects to life or showcase their work to a wider audience. art underwriting helps to bridge this gap by providing artists with the necessary resources to continue creating and sharing their work.
